The need for separating a place for storage battery strongly complicates life to the contemporary designers, who want to release thin and light electronic devices. Overall dimensions, limitations of capacity and high batteries cost hold in control development relative to the young industry segment - here we deal with electromobiles and so-called hybrid automobiles, which combine internal combustion engine and electromotors.
British scientists, developed a material, capable of storing electric charge and in this case remain sufficiently durable . Composite material consists of carbon fibers and polymeric resin, during the charging and the discharging chemical reactions does not occur, which reduce the charging time . Reductions in the capacity throughout time is not also observed.
Volvo company is already interested in this material. The decrease in the mass of automobile by 15%, achieved by this replacement, will increase the path of hybrid automobile on electro-traction. For the development of this material, it was already spent 3.4 ml Euros, in further plans of inventors enters the improvement of material properties and the preparation at the beginning for its production on industrial scales.
